AS the Philippine automotive industry confronts one of the most significant transitions in its history, government officials, industry executives, and mobility experts gathered at The Heritage Hotel Manila on May 21, 2026, for The Manila Times Automotive Forum titled “Mobility at a Crossroads: Navigating the Philippines’ Oil Dependence and Electric Future.”

Organized by The Manila Times, the forum examined how the country can balance the continued dominance of gasoline and diesel-powered vehicles with the growing presence of electric vehicles (EVs) hybrids, plug-in hybrids, battery-electric vehicles, and emerging technologies such as hydrogen fuel cells.
